(TBI) reported a first-quarter 2026 loss per share of -$0.41, exceeding the consensus estimate of -$0.4545 by 9.79%. Revenue figures were not disclosed in the initial release. Following the announcement, the stock price rose 2.34%, suggesting a positive market response to the narrower-than-expected loss.

TrueBlue’s Q1 2026 results reflect ongoing headwinds in the staffing and workforce solutions industry, where demand remains pressured by broader economic uncertainty. Despite reporting a negative EPS, the company managed to outperform analyst expectations by nearly 10%, indicating effective cost controls and operational discipline. Margin trends likely benefited from restructuring efforts and a focus on higher-margin service lines, though specific segment data was not provided. The labor market environment continues to challenge revenue growth, with clients exercising caution in hiring. TrueBlue’s ability to generate a smaller loss than anticipated suggests that management’s initiatives to streamline operations and reduce overhead may be gaining traction. However, the absence of revenue details leaves questions about top-line momentum. The company’s performance in temporary staffing, on-site management, and recruitment process outsourcing may have contributed to the earnings surprise, but concrete figures were withheld. Overall, the quarter highlights a mixed picture: a positive EPS beat against a backdrop of persistent industry softness. TrueBlue Inc.
